Non-Canonical Control of Neuronal Energy Status by the Na+ Pump (Cell Metabolism)
 


Using fluorescent sensors for ions and metabolites Baeza-Lehnert et al. mapped the metabolic response to synaptic transmission in vitro and in vivo. Neurons showed perfect energetic stability that was attributed to control of ATP production by the Na+ pump, as opposed to conventional homeostasis mediated by ADP, ATP, and Ca2+.
